Civil litigation lawyers in Worcester Massachusetts handle disputes between individuals and businesses that do not involve criminal charges. These attorneys represent clients in Worcester Superior Court and the Massachusetts District Court system. Massachusetts law follows specific procedural rules including the Massachusetts Rules of Civil Procedure which govern how lawsuits are filed and managed.

What Does a Civil Litigation Lawyer in Worcester Cost?

Civil litigation lawyers in Massachusetts typically charge by the hour with rates ranging from 250 to 600 dollars per hour depending on experience and case complexity. Some attorneys offer flat fees for simple matters or contingency fees for personal injury cases where they take a percentage of any settlement. Costs also include court filing fees expert witness fees and discovery expenses. This is general information and not legal adv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of cases does a civil litigation lawyer handle in Worcester?
A civil litigation lawyer in Worcester handles cases such as breach of contract property disputes personal injury claims landlord tenant issues and business partnership disagreements. These cases are filed in either Worcester Superior Court or the local District Court depending on the amount of money involved.
What is the statute of limitations for filing a civil lawsuit in Massachusetts?
In Massachusetts the statute of limitations for most contract disputes is six years from the date of breach. For personal injury claims the time limit is three years from the date of the injury. It is critical to file within these deadlines or you may lose your right to sue.
How do I choose a civil litigation lawyer in Worcester?
Look for a lawyer with experience in Massachusetts civil procedure and familiarity with Worcester County courts. You can check the Massachusetts Board of Bar Overseers website to verify a lawyers license and disciplinary history. Schedule an initial consultation to discuss your case and fee structure before hiring.
